Renovation of a military facility in Happy Valley-Goose Bay, Newfoundland. Completed plans call for the renovation of a military facility.
Closing Time: 2:30 PM NT ** Please note that there has been 1 addendum issued for this project. ** WORK COVERED BY PROJECT DOCUMENTS .1 Work of this Project comprises of Renovations to 600 Bungalow Residential Housing Units Exterior at Canadian Forces Base 5 Wing, Happy Valley - Goose Bay Newfoundland and Labrador (NL). The work shall include, but is not limited to, the supply and installation of all products, services, labour, materials, and equipment required to complete the project. .2 The work under this project includes, but is not necessarily limited to the total performance of the Work (plant, labour, materials, and equipment), to the description and intent of this specification and the following: .1 Demolition of existing exterior building features as noted on Architectural, Structural Mechanical and Electrical Drawings and Specifications. .2 Removal of all abandoned phone/TV and telecom cables. .3 Removal of exterior cladding components to expose board sheathing, visual inspection to occur. Replacement of board sheathing encountered. .4 Provision and installation of new vinyl siding and upgrade insulation value for walls. .5 Provision and replacement of all exterior entrance doors including new hardware. .6 Provision and replacement of all existing exterior windows with new vinyl hung windows. .7 Provision and extension of canopy roof and windbreaks on front entrance including new reinforced concrete pads and concrete walkways. .8 Provision and replacement of asphalt roof shingles with new asphalt shingles and roof vents along with rain gutters and downspout. .9 Provision and replacement of all exterior electrical devices such as; light fixtures, receptacles, door bell pushbutton, etc. .10 Relocation of active lines/satellite dishes. .11 Provision of branch wiring for new devices. .12 Removal and reinstallation of new masts and weather heads for Power Service Entrance and Telecom. .13 Provision of new service conductors. .14 Provision and replacement of all exterior mechanical devices, hose bibs, dryer exhaust hoods, range exhaust hood c/w 230mm tail piece, backdraft damper and anti-gust capabilities, white metal. .15 Provisions of wood patio framing with railings, stairs and decking on reinforced concrete foundations. .16 Upon award, but prior to the start of work, the Contractor should perform a site visit and meet with DCC Representative to help create Work Plan and to determine the general requirements listed within this specification. The Contractor will use professional opinion to determine the most effective Methodology for completing the Work. The Contractor will be responsible for confirming or outlining the details within this Work Plan, which is to be submitted to and reviewed by DCC Representative and will accommodate the operational requirements and temporary set-ups in other locations of the work forces operating within the building. .17 The Contractor shall provide a detailed schedule/ GANTT/timeline to the DCC Representative for review prior to starting the work, and coordinate schedule with DCC Representative during the Work. The Contractor shall submit to the DCC Representative for approval of progress schedule, which shall be updated on a bi-weekly basis for the duration of the work. .19 Work performed by the Contractor will be comprised of the provision of all labour, material and equipment required to complete the installation work, in accordance with the specifications and drawings for this project. .20 The Contractor shall be responsible for acquiring the necessary access and lifting equipment such as lifts, cranes to be operated by a licensed operator. Scaffolding shall be approved by a licensed engineer in the province of Newfoundland and Labrador. .21 The Contractor shall be responsible for making arrangements with, and obtaining permits from, authorities having jurisdiction for disposal of waste and debris. Copies of manifests and disposal records will be submitted to the DCC Representative. .22 The Contractor is responsible for the compliance of their own forces and of their subcontractors with the Requirements outlined within the Specification. .23 All work performed by the Contractor and Sub-Contractors shall be in accordance with the applicable federal and provincial codes and regulations, standards, specifications, and drawings. .24 The Contractor shall provide all temporary facilities and utilities needed to ensure that occupied areas are safely accessible and supplied with utilities. .25 The Contractor shall coordinate with the Platoon Chief at the Fire Hall for a Fire Hall briefing of all staff prior to the start of work. .26 Contractor shall maintain emergency vehicle access. .3 Contractor to carry out works in accordance with construction drawings and specifications.
